
Latent Labs: Revolutionizing Biology with AI
In an ambitious leap into the intersection of AI and biotechnology, Latent Labs has officially launched, backed by a staggering $50 million in funding. Founded by Simon Kohl, a former scientist at DeepMind, the startup aims to create AI models that make the complexities of biology more manageable and efficient. The company’s primary goal is to partner with biotech and pharmaceutical firms to construct and fine-tune proteins, essential building blocks of life.
Understanding the Protein Paradigm
Proteins play a critical role in human biology, acting as enzymes, hormones, and antibodies. They are synthesized from approximately 20 amino acids, which link in specific sequences, folding into distinct 3D structures that dictate their functionality. Traditional methods for understanding these structures have been painstakingly slow; however, AlphaFold from DeepMind has drastically accelerated this process by predicting the shapes of around 200 million proteins using machine learning models.
The Birth of Latent Labs
Simon Kohl embarked on his journey with Latent Labs after witnessing firsthand the potential of generative modeling in protein design during his time with the AlphaFold team. His decision to found a more focused startup was driven by the realization that the field of protein design is vast and ripe for exploration. Since its inception, Latent Labs has built a talented team, including experts from prestigious institutions, operating from London and San Francisco. This dual-location strategy enables them to not only develop theoretical models but also test them directly in real-world conditions.
